Material Prep Work Methods
Effective manufacturing of HDPE pipelines starts with meticulous material preparation strategies, particularly the extrusion process. Throughout this stage, high-density polyethylene resin is first dried to remove wetness, making certain ideal circulation attributes. The resin is after that fed right into the extruder, where it goes through heating and melting, changing right into a thick state. This heating process is very carefully managed to keep the product's stability and efficiency. The liquified HDPE is required via a die, forming it into a why not try this out constant pipeline type. Appropriate temperature level administration throughout extrusion is essential, as it straight affects the product's properties and the end product quality. Once shaped, the HDPE pipe is cooled down and cut to defined sizes, prepared for subsequent processing and i thought about this applications.

Quality Assurance Actions in HDPE Manufacturing
Various aspects affect the high quality of HDPE pipeline production, reliable quality control actions are crucial to guarantee consistency and reliability in the last product (American Plastics HDPE Pipe for Oilfield). Secret high quality control practices include extensive material inspection, verifying that the raw polyethylene fulfills well established standards for purity and density. Throughout the extrusion process, parameters such as temperature, stress, and cooling time are very closely kept track of to keep dimensional accuracy and structural honesty
On top of that, post-production screening is essential; manufacturers frequently perform hydrostatic tests to evaluate the pipeline's stamina and resistance to stress. Visual examinations for surface area defects further boost top quality guarantee. Accreditation from relevant requirements companies, like ASTM or ISO, offers an added layer of integrity. By executing these comprehensive top quality control steps, producers can lessen flaws, improve efficiency, and make sure that the HDPE pipes satisfy the specific requirements of numerous applications, ultimately causing customer complete satisfaction and count on the product.

Agricultural Irrigation Networks
Agricultural watering networks profit considerably from making use of high-density polyethylene (HDPE) pipelines, which give efficient and trusted water distribution to plants. HDPE pipes are lightweight, making them easy to transport and set up, while their adaptability enables for different configurations in varied surfaces. These pipes demonstrate excellent resistance to deterioration, chemicals, and UV radiation, making sure durability in severe farming environments. Additionally, their smooth interior surface area minimizes friction loss, optimizing water flow and minimizing power prices connected with pumping. The longevity of HDPE pipes, usually surpassing 50 years, adds to lower upkeep and replacement expenditures. Farmers progressively depend on HDPE pipelines to boost watering performance and promote lasting agricultural techniques, eventually leading to enhanced plant yields and resource conservation.

Future Trends in HDPE Pipeline Innovation
As the demand for lasting and reliable facilities grows, advancements in HDPE pipeline modern technology are poised to transform various markets. Arising fads consist of the integration of wise technologies, such as sensing units and IoT capabilities, which promote real-time monitoring of pipeline conditions, minimizing upkeep costs and avoiding leaks. Furthermore, the development of innovative production methods, such as 3D printing, is enabling the production of complex, personalized pipe designs that accommodate particular job demands.
In addition, the focus on recycling and round economic situation practices is driving the innovation of HDPE pipes made from recycled materials, enhancing sustainability. Improved jointing methods, such as electro-fusion and mechanical fittings, are additionally enhancing installation effectiveness and reliability. The expanding emphasis on environmental guidelines is pushing makers to embrace greener production procedures, guaranteeing that HDPE pipelines not just satisfy sector standards however also cultivate a more sustainable future for facilities growth.
